Generally need the relevant hardware for development and testing. +Expert: Only attempt these if you've successfully completed some tricky +refactorings already and are an expert in the specific area + Subsystem-wide refactorings =========================== @@ -168,6 +171,22 @@ Contact: Daniel Vetter, respective driver maintainers Level: Advanced +Move Buffer Object Locking to dma_resv_lock() +--------------------------------------------- + +Many drivers have their own per-object locking scheme, usually using +mutex_lock(). This causes all kinds of trouble for buffer sharing, since +depending which driver is the exporter and importer, the locking hierarchy is +reversed. + +To solve this we need one standard per-object locking mechanism, which is +dma_resv_lock(). This lock needs to be called as the outermost lock, with all +other driver specific per-object locks removed. The problem is tha rolling out +the actual change to the locking contract is a flag day, due to struct dma_buf +buffer sharing. + +Level: Expert + Convert logging to drm_* functions with drm_device paramater ------------------------------------------------------------
